Below is a (non-exhaustive) list of things we do not allow:
Providing inappropriate content
Posting, uploading, sharing, submitting or otherwise providing Content that:
- contains viruses, bots, worms, scripting exploits or other similar harmful (or potentially harmful) materials;
- infringes ours or any third party’s intellectual property rights, including but not limited to any copyright, trademark, patent, trade secret, etc.;
- is illegal, fraudulent, deceptive, obscene, defamatory, libelous, threatening, harmful to minors, pornographic, indecent, harassing, hateful, inflammatory or anything similar to the foregoing;
- attacks others based on their race, ethnicity, national origin, religion, sex, gender, sexual orientation, disability or medical condition;
- encourages illegal, reckless or otherwise inappropriate conduct; or
- could otherwise cause damage to us or any third party.
For the purpose hereof, the term “Content” means any information, data, text, code, scripts, sound, photos, graphics, videos, tags, interactive features or other materials that you post, upload, share, submit or otherwise provide in any manner to, or in connection with the Products or us.
Disruptive activities
- Disabling, modifying or compromising the integrity or performance of our Products or systems, which inter alia may include probing, scanning, or testing the vulnerability of any system or network that hosts our Products (except for security assessments expressly permitted by us);
- Reverse-engineering, hacking or tampering with our Products or systems, circumventing any security or authentication measures or attempting to gain unauthorized access to our Products, related systems, networks or data;
- Deciphering any transmissions to or from the servers running the Products;
- Imposing an unreasonably large load on our systems that consume extraordinary resources (CPUs, memory, disk space, bandwidth, etc.), which may include (i) using “robots”, “spiders”, “offline readers” or other automated systems to send more request messages to our servers than a human could reasonably send in the same period of time by using a normal browser, (ii) going far beyond the use parameters for any given Product as described in its corresponding documentation, or (iii) consuming an unreasonable amount of storage in a way that is unrelated to the purposes for which the Product were designed.
Wrongful activities
- Using our Products for any illegal purpose or in violation of any laws (including without limitation data, privacy and export control laws);
- Using our Products to stalk, harass or provide threats of violence against others, or to violate the privacy of others;
- Misrepresentation of yourself or disguising the origin of any content (including by “spoofing”, “phishing” or other identifiers, impersonating anyone else;
- Accessing or searching any part of our Products by any means other than our publicly supported interfaces (for example, “scraping”);
- Using meta tags or any other “hidden text” including our or our suppliers’ product names or trademarks;
- Using our Products for the purpose of providing alerts on disaster scenarios or any other situations directly related to health or safety, including but not limited to acts of terrorism, natural disasters or emergency response.
Inappropriate communications
- Using the Products to generate or send unsolicited communications, advertising, chain letters, or spam;
- Soliciting our users for commercial purposes, unless expressly permitted by us;
- Disparaging us or our partners, vendors or affiliates;
- Promoting or advertising products or services other than your own without appropriate authorization.
